I've just bought a 1800 1994 Golf GL and have a couple of questions/probs to deal with.



- After completely warming up the delivery of power is not smooth, there appear to be flatspots and the power seems to take a second to kick in after depressing the accellerator.



- Once very hot the tickover drops to 600 and the problems above are exagerrated. Pulling away becomes difficult because the engine hesitates briefly on accelleration.



The car has recently been serviced and has new plugs.

Is this the 75bhp single point or 90bhp multi point engine?

If its the latter then firstly have the fuel injector removed and ultrasonically cleaned, clean the throttle body, then have the injection system checked with special attention payed to the idle stepper motor, vacuum leaks around the manifold, and air mass meter readings.
